Germinator Combines Multi-Stage Air and Surface Disinfection with Environmental Monitoring

PITTSBURGH, PA, UNITED STATES, September 1, 2026 /EINPresswire.com/ -- Jo E. of Bells, TN is the creator of the Germinator, an automated air and surface disinfection system designed to help reduce the transmission of contagious viruses in high-traffic indoor environments. The system is intended for installation at critical transition points, including doorways, corridors, building entrances, and access gates, where individuals frequently pass through and where airborne particles and contaminated surfaces can contribute to pathogen transmission.

The compact unit measures approximately 12 inches in length and 5 inches in width, with a slanted front profile designed to integrate with over-the-door or side-door architectural configurations. An internal compartment houses a disinfectant delivery system containing up to six spray nozzles or nodules. A sensor bar positioned below the spray outlets can detect individuals as they pass through the designated area that triggers the release of a fine disinfectant mist intended to treat surrounding air and surfaces within an approximately 5.5-foot radius. The automated approach reduces reliance on manually applied disinfectants and allows treatment to occur as people move through designated transition areas.

Germinator can also incorporate multiple supplemental sanitization technologies within the same housing. Snap-in HEPA and activated-carbon filters can provide particulate and contaminant removal, while a UV-C LED chamber can be used for pathogen inactivation within the device. A bipolar ionization grid can provide an additional mechanism for treating aerosolized particles. Environmental sensors can monitor factors including particulate concentration and humidity, while system connectivity can enable centralized monitoring, operational control, and data collection across multiple installed units. These capabilities allow the system to function as both a localized disinfection device and a networked environmental monitoring platform.

High-traffic indoor environments can present challenges for infection-control programs because individuals continuously introduce and redistribute airborne particles and potentially contaminated material. Conventional cleaning procedures generally depend on scheduled or manually performed disinfection and create periods between treatments in which environmental conditions can change. In addition, traditional surface-cleaning practices do not directly address continuously circulating aerosolized particles.

The Germinator is designed to complement established cleaning and infection-control procedures by placing automated treatment and environmental monitoring directly at points of frequent human movement. Rather than relying exclusively on periodic manual intervention, the system combines sensing, controlled disinfectant delivery, filtration, UV-C treatment, ionization, and environmental data collection within a compact installation. The architecture provides facility operators with an additional technical layer for managing environmental contamination and monitoring conditions in areas where large numbers of people routinely pass through.
